He was a native of Pleasant Garden and was a manager for a Hardware Distributor. He was a World War II marine veteran and a member of the Greensboro Amateur Radio Club.
Surviving are wife, Mrs. Jennie G. Cooper, daughter, Mrs. Ember Wells of Fort Mill, S.C.; sister, Mrs. Geraldine Kirkpatrick of Greensboro; one grandchild.
Memorial may be made to the American Cancer Society or Grace United Methodist Church.
Greensboro News and Record, July 17, 1986
